Coal pollution mitigation - Wikipedia

Coal Pollution Mitigation, sometimes also known as Clean Coal, is a series of systems and technologies that seek to mitigate (reduce harmful or unpleasant chemicals) health and environmental impact of coal; in particular air pollution from coal-fired power stations, and from coal burnt by heavy industry. How clean is clean coal? ODI: Think change

Increased efficiency means advanced coal can produce 40% less CO2 than conventional plants. This is impressive, but it’s not enough. Even the most advanced coal plant produces around 30 times more CO2 than wind and hydro, twenty times more than solar and geothermal, and 50% more than natural gas. It’s a similar story for other air pollutants.

CLEAN COAL: FACTSHEET - Climate Council

calls “clean coal”) emit significant greenhouse gases. A new high-efficiency coal plant run on black coal would produce about 80% of the emissions of an equivalent old plant (Figure 1), while renewables (eg. wind and solar) emit zero emissions. So-called “clean coal” does not help Australia meet its obligations to reduce its emissions ...

Clean Coal Is Crucial for American Jobs, Energy Security, and

2020.6.26  Coal-fired electricity generation is cleaner than ever. NETL’s research shows that a new coal plant with pollution controls reduces nitrogen oxides by 83 percent, sulfur dioxide by 98 percent, and particulate matter by 99.8 percent compared to plants without controls.

Coal Department of Energy Philippines

The Philippines is largely a coal consuming country with coal having the highest contribution to the power generation mix at 58% in 2021. But, local demand for coal is not limited to power generation. In 2021, the cement industry utilized 6.66% of the country’s coal supply, 7.08% went to other industries such as alcohol, sinter, rubber boots ...
